MAG Hedge Fund Activity: Q1 2020 in Review
96 of the 4,538 institutional investors tracked by Wall St. Rank reported a position in MAG Silver (MAG) for Q1 2020, worth a combined $237M — down 51% from $480M a quarter earlier.
Buyers outnumbered sellers: 19 funds opened new MAG positions and 18 closed out — a net gain of 1 holder — while 29 added to existing stakes and 35 trimmed.
The largest buyer was Sprott Inc, adding an estimated $74.3M. The largest seller was Tocqueville Asset Management, cutting an estimated $75.1M.
